Subject: Validator plugin cut-over complete

Hi, welcome aboard. Over the weekend we moved Fieldgate's data validators onto the new plugin loader. All legacy inline checks were retired; each validator now registers via the manifest and loads at startup. Rollback is possible for two weeks if something breaks. Before you touch anything, review the active settings the service booted with, shown below.

deployment values, yadug-bawif:
[framir]
team = pelox
access_code = ac_a38ab2
owner = tamion.julael
host = framir.tolvaqlabs.test
port = 11211
peer = tammir.zemvargrid.local
salt = 2215ef03
pin = 1541

## Escalation: Vendored Fonts

If your plugin bundles third-party fonts through the Typekettle pipeline and the license checker flags them, don't just re-upload and hope. First, confirm the font family is on the approved list in the Glyphbarn registry. If it's not there, or the checker keeps rejecting a font that clearly should pass, that's an escalation — we'd rather hear from you early than untangle a shipped plugin later. Send the font name, version, and checker output to the licensing desk.

escalation mailbox, bafog-fafog: ulador@paliqlabs.internal

**Mgmt Meeting Minutes — Retiring the Brightline Range**

Quick recap for sales leads at Fenholt Supplies: we agreed to retire the Brightline fixture range by year-end. Remaining stock moves to clearance pricing next month, and accounts on standing orders get migrated to the Lumetta range. Trade-in incentives were approved in principle. The confidential note on next steps sits just below.

board note of bajof-bajeg: The pricing group signed off on a budget of $13.4 million for Project Sildor. The renewal with Lamixek Holdings closes at $48.9 million a year, 49 percent above the last contract.

Subject: Handover — Restock Planner DB

Hi team, passing the vending-machine restock planner (Snackline) over to Dmitri while I'm out. Nightly planner job is stable; just watch the forecast table growth. Support can run read-only queries against the replica. For that, use the connection string below.

primary connection of yagep-kahip = redis://giliel_svc:zYiKsLL2PLpfPL@db-348f.xolmarsys.corp:5432/fenwyn